SHENZHEN (PEN): The China Electronics Chamber of Commerce’s (CECC) Supply Chain and Logistics Professional Committee (SCLC) Secretary and Vice Chairman Shi Jinhui has said that Chinese enterprises should invest in the logistics sector of Pakistan as it is rapidly expanding. A strategic agreement has been reached between the Pakistani Consulate General in China and the CECC during the 2021 China (Shenzhen) Supply Chain and Logistics Summit Forum. In an interview, Jinhui said that Pakistan’s e-commerce is rapidly expanding from all cities. He also said that the development of logistics in Pakistan will immensely boost entire logistics industry in the region.
